Gaza runs out of cancer medicines, as Israeli strikes continue

Gaza runs out of cancer medicines, as Israeli strikes continue

Summary

Cancer medicines have run out in Gaza’s Al-Aqsa Martyrs Hospital. This happened after an Israeli strike damaged the hospital’s water tanks, lab equipment, and storage areas.

Key Facts

  • Gaza’s Al-Aqsa Martyrs Hospital has no more cancer medicines left.
  • An Israeli strike caused damage to the hospital’s water tanks.
  • The strike also damaged laboratory equipment at the hospital.
  • Storage areas for medicines at the hospital were hit and destroyed.
  • The medicines shortage adds to the difficulties caused by the ongoing conflict.
  • Gaza is a small territory facing intense fighting and blockades.
  • The hospital is an important medical center for local residents.
